You should take notes next time you play, so that you have actual data.

Observations of things like these are easily influenced by bias, if you make up your opinion based on how it “feels” rather than actual hard data.
Basically any observer will have their observations influenced by their already existing ideas.
Also, people usually pay special attention to things that feel extraordinary.
For example, if you roll a dice and get 6-6-6-6-6-6, that seems incredibly unlikely and feels very special. You would probably remember that and think about it.
If you roll 2-4-3-5-5-1 instead, you will probably not think about it at all, despite both outcomes having the same probability of occuring. One of the two just feels more special and you will remember it.

About a year ago, a bunch of people claimed something among the lines of “vet is the most played class by far” and “all classes almost always play autopistol or boltgun” and demanded nerfs on that basis. None of them had actual data and they all went by their feeling.
So i gathered some data and it looked a lot like almost everything they had claimed based on their “feeling” was factually wrong.
